"Is a health crisis a case of force majeure? The answer cannot be taken for granted, because it is not (legally) clearly evident. This is because up to now, all health situations have not necessarily been judged as such: Ebola, dengue fever, chikungunya virus or even H1N1 (avian flu)," explained Thierry Chiron, lawyer and co-president of the French ACE (Avocats Conseils d'Entreprises) sports law committee, to News Tank Football on 14/04/2020.

"In French law, for example, for there to be force majeure, there must be an objective event which meets three conditions: it must be beyond the control of the debtor; it must be unforeseeable at the time of the formation of the contract; and it must make it impossible to fulfill the (contractual) obligation," explained the lawyer who analyzes these legal criteria with the coronavirus (Covid-19) pandemic which has already killed at least 120,000 people worldwide as of 14/04/2020.
